- POTEE's encodes is recorded as POTE ankyrin domain family member E[14].
- POTEE's found in taxon is recorded as Homo sapiens[15].
- POTEE's chromosome is recorded as human chromosome 2[16].
- POTEE's strand orientation is recorded as forward strand[17].
- POTEE's exact match is recorded as http://identifiers.org/ncbigene/445582[18].
- POTEE's cytogenetic location is recorded as 2q21.1[19].
- POTEE's expressed in is recorded as testicle[20].
- POTEE's expressed in is recorded as gonad[21].
- POTEE's expressed in is recorded as ganglionic eminence[22].
- POTEE's expressed in is recorded as left testis[23].
- POTEE's expressed in is recorded as placenta[24].
- POTEE's expressed in is recorded as right testis[25].
- POTEE's expressed in is recorded as prostate[26].
